[HISTORY: Adopted by the Board of Selectmen of the Town of
Ashford 10-14-1975. Amendments
noted where applicable.]
This Board of Selectmen hereby:
A. Assures
the Federal Insurance Administration that it will enact as necessary
and maintain in force, for those areas having flood hazards, adequate
land use and control measures with effective enforcement provisions
consistent with the criteria set forth in Section 1910 of the National
Flood Insurance Program Regulations.
B. Vests the
Planning and Zoning Commission with the responsibility, authority,
and means to:
(1) Delineate or assist the Administrator, at his request, in delineating
the limits of the areas having special flood hazards on available
local maps of sufficient scale to identify the location of building
sites.
(2) Provide such information as the Administrator may request concerning
present uses and occupancy of the floodplain.
(3) Cooperate with federal, state, and local agencies and private firms
which undertake to study, survey, map, and identify floodplain areas
and cooperate with neighboring communities with respect to management
of adjoining floodplain areas in order to prevent aggravation of existing
hazards.
(4) Submit, on the anniversary date of the community's initial eligibility,
an annual report to the Administrator on the progress made during
the past year within the community in the development and implementation
of floodplain management measures.
C. Appoints
the Planning and Zoning Commission to maintain, for public inspection
and to furnish upon request, a record of elevations (in relation to
mean sea level) of the lowest floor (including basement) of all new
or substantially improved structures located in the special flood
hazard areas. If the lowest floor is below grade on one or more sides,
the elevation of the floor immediately above must also be recorded.
D. Agrees
to take such other official action as may be reasonably necessary
to carry out the objectives of the program.
